RTSH, the Albanian broadcaster has made some changes this year to the usual format of Festivali i Këngës, reducing the number of artists to 16. Also the festival dates have changed to 26,27 and 28.
Today, RTSH revealed the names of the 16 artists competing this year for a chance to represent Albania in Denmark. Quite a few familiar names to fans of Albanian Eurovision will return to Festivali i Këngës in December. Previous Eurovision Song Contest entrants include Frederik Ndoci (2007) and Luiz Ejlli (2006).
The semi-finals of FiK are scheduled for 26 and 27 December 2013 and the final will be transmitted from Tirana on 28 December. In each semi-final 8 songs will be performed and all the 16 songs will proceed to the final. What is new this year is that after each artist performs their entry, they will duet past festival entries with a “big” artist.
The competing acts for Festivali i Këngës 2013 are:
- Ti mungon – Marjeta Billo
- Zemërimi i një nate – Herciana Matmuja
- Jeta në orën 4 – Orges Toce
- Jam larg – Besiana Mehmeti and Shkodran Tolaj
- Grua – Sajmir Braho
- Nuk e di – Renis Gjoka
- Natë e pare – Venera Lumani and Lindi Islami
- Një ditë shprese – Frederik Ndoci
- Në zemër – Rezarta Smaja
- Mikja ime – Blerina Braka
- Me ty – Klodian Kacani
- Kur qielli qan – Xhejn & Enxhi Kumrija
- Kthehu – Luiz Ejlli
- Princesha – Lynx
- Vetëm për ty – Saviana Verdha and Edmond Mancaku
- Ëndërrat janë ëndërra – Xhejsi Jorgaqi
